Detailed Description

The QItemDelegate class provides display and editing facilities for data items from a model.

\inmodule QtWidgets

QItemDelegate can be used to provide custom display features and editor widgets for item views based on QAbstractItemView subclasses. Using a delegate for this purpose allows the display and editing mechanisms to be customized and developed independently from the model and view.

The QItemDelegate class is one of the \l{Model/View Classes} and is part of Qt's \l{Model/View Programming}{model/view framework}. Note that QStyledItemDelegate has taken over the job of drawing Qt's item views. We recommend the use of QStyledItemDelegate when creating new delegates.

When displaying items from a custom model in a standard view, it is often sufficient to simply ensure that the model returns appropriate data for each of the \l{Qt::ItemDataRole}{roles} that determine the appearance of items in views. The default delegate used by Qt's standard views uses this role information to display items in most of the common forms expected by users. However, it is sometimes necessary to have even more control over the appearance of items than the default delegate can provide.

This class provides default implementations of the functions for painting item data in a view and editing data from item models. Default implementations of the paint() and sizeHint() virtual functions, defined in QAbstractItemDelegate, are provided to ensure that the delegate implements the correct basic behavior expected by views. You can reimplement these functions in subclasses to customize the appearance of items.

When editing data in an item view, QItemDelegate provides an editor widget, which is a widget that is placed on top of the view while editing takes place. Editors are created with a QItemEditorFactory; a default static instance provided by QItemEditorFactory is installed on all item delegates. You can set a custom factory using setItemEditorFactory() or set a new default factory with QItemEditorFactory::setDefaultFactory(). It is the data stored in the item model with the Qt::EditRole that is edited.

◆ eventFilter()

bool QItemDelegate::eventFilter ( QObject editor,
QEvent event 
)
overrideprotectedvirtual

Returns true if the given editor is a valid QWidget and the given event is handled; otherwise returns false. The following key press events are handled by default:

\list

  • \uicontrol Tab
  • \uicontrol Backtab
  • \uicontrol Enter
  • \uicontrol Return
  • \uicontrol Esc \endlist

In the case of \uicontrol Tab, \uicontrol Backtab, \uicontrol Enter and \uicontrol Return key press events, the editor's data is committed to the model and the editor is closed. If the event is a \uicontrol Tab key press the view will open an editor on the next item in the view. Likewise, if the event is a \uicontrol Backtab key press the view will open an editor on the previous item in the view.

If the event is a \uicontrol Esc key press event, the editor is closed without committing its data.

◆ paint()

void QItemDelegate::paint ( QPainter painter,
const QStyleOptionViewItem &  option,
const QModelIndex index 
) const
overridevirtual

Renders the delegate using the given painter and style option for the item specified by index.

When reimplementing this function in a subclass, you should update the area held by the option's \l{QStyleOption::rect}{rect} variable, using the option's \l{QStyleOption::state}{state} variable to determine the state of the item to be displayed, and adjust the way it is painted accordingly.

For example, a selected item may need to be displayed differently to unselected items, as shown in the following code:

\dots

After painting, you should ensure that the painter is returned to its the state it was supplied in when this function was called. For example, it may be useful to call QPainter::save() before painting and QPainter::restore() afterwards.

◆ sizeHint()

QSize QItemDelegate::sizeHint ( const QStyleOptionViewItem &  option,
const QModelIndex index 
) const
overridevirtual

Returns the size needed by the delegate to display the item specified by index, taking into account the style information provided by option.

When reimplementing this function, note that in case of text items, QItemDelegate adds a margin (i.e. 2 * QStyle::PM_FocusFrameHMargin) to the length of the text.

Property Documentation

◆ clipping

QItemDelegate::clipping
readwrite

if the delegate should clip the paint events

Since
4.2

This property will set the paint clip to the size of the item. The default value is on. It is useful for cases such as when images are larger than the size of the item.
